The DataPro 9213 series Computer Power Cord is used to provide 220 volt power to a PC
or Macintosh type computer or peripheral.
This is the power cord used in Italy, Malta, Chile, and Libya. Bonus points if you can figure out why
it's that particular combination of countries.
The CPU side has a 3-prong "PC" power type bevelled connector; the wall outlet end has
an Italian type 220-volt outlet connector. The official names for these connectors are
IEC 60320-1 C13 and CEI 23-16/VII 10A, respectively. Note: The 10A Italian connector
has pins that are thinner and closer together than the 16A connector, although
both are classified as CEI 23-16/VII.
Both ends are 3-prong to provide maximum
grounding.
